Typical Tree Issues Certified Arborists Can Address?
Numerous homeowners face numerous tree-related challenges that have the potential to undermine the health and safety of their yards. Frequent issues encompass pests, diseases, and structural deficiencies that often go unrecognized until they escalate. Insect infestations such as aphids and borers can damage trees, causing leaves to discolor or branches to die back. Furthermore, fungal diseases like root rot and leaf spot can undermine tree wellness, often requiring prompt intervention to limit further damage. Physical problems, such as improper branching or unstable trunks, pose risks during storms, potentially leading to property damage. Nutritional shortfalls, often indicated by discolored foliage or stunted growth, also impact tree health. Through early identification of these issues, homeowners can minimize dangers and protect the beauty of their landscapes. Certified arborists have the expertise and equipment to accurately identify these problems, providing customized remedies to sustain and revitalize tree health.

Tree Health Evaluation Methods
Assessing tree health necessitates a sharp eye and specialized knowledge that only trained professionals possess. Professional arborists utilize multiple assessment approaches to gauge the health of trees. Visual assessments are critical, allowing arborists to identify signs of decay, stress, or structural problems. Moreover, they may use tools such as specialized boring tools to assess wood density and growth patterns, providing insights into the tree's history and health. Soil testing is another vital technique, as it reveals nutrient levels and pH, important for optimal growth. Arborists also evaluate the surrounding environment, considering factors like moisture levels and competition from other vegetation. By integrating these methods, licensed arborists deliver comprehensive evaluations that guide suitable care and maintenance strategies for trees and surrounding landscapes.

Expert Pruning Techniques
Pruning trees with skill and expertise reshapes landscapes, promoting both health and aesthetic appeal. Skilled arborists use sophisticated methods that improve tree structure and development. By selectively removing branches, they enhance light penetration and air circulation, which are critical for the overall health of trees. Correct pruning reduces the likelihood of disease and pest problems by removing dead or congested branches, enabling vigorous growth to thrive. Furthermore, experienced arborists recognize the distinct growth habits of different tree species, ensuring that each tree receives tailored care. This knowledge enhances not only the visual symmetry of the landscape but also supports the ecological balance of the surrounding environment. Overall, skilled pruning practices make a substantial difference in the enduring vitality and beauty of trees and landscapes.

Soil Wellness Management
Thriving landscapes start with strong soil foundations, as it supplies vital nutrients and structural support for vegetation. Trained arborists take a vital part in maintaining soil health by evaluating soil composition, pH levels, and drainage capabilities. They implement strategies such as soil aeration, organic amendments, and proper mulching to improve nutrient absorption and promote microbial growth. By fostering a balanced ecosystem, these professionals guarantee that trees receive the necessary elements for growth, minimizing stress and susceptibility to plant diseases. Moreover, nutrient-rich soil supports the formation of strong root networks, which improve stability and resilience against environmental challenges. As a result, prioritizing professional tree care not only elevates the visual beauty of landscapes but also contributes to lasting ecological sustainability.
Choosing the Right Certified Arborist
How does one ensure they choose the right certified arborist for their tree maintenance requirements? First, individuals should confirm the arborist's credentials through recognized organizations, confirming they have the necessary training and expertise. One should consider seeking recommendations from friends, family, or local gardening centers, as word-of-mouth recommendations frequently connect people with dependable specialists.
Following this step, those seeking tree services should meet with a number of arborists, inquiring about their qualifications, specializations, and tree maintenance philosophy. Observing their communication style and willingness to answer questions can demonstrate their devotion to serving their clients well.
Furthermore, looking up online feedback and investigating any grievances with regional regulatory organizations can shed more light on an arborist's standing. Lastly, obtaining written estimates and understanding the services included will assist in reaching a well-informed choice. Picking the appropriate certified arborist is critical for guaranteeing the health and longevity of trees and surrounding landscapes.

What Occurs During Your Arborist Consultation?
When undergoing an arborist consultation, a comprehensive inspection of the trees and surrounding landscape is performed to pinpoint any existing concerns and determine the best course of action. The professional arborist commences by evaluating the health of the trees, looking for signs of pest infestations, disease, or structural vulnerabilities. They further examine the ground conditions and nearby plant life, as these factors markedly influence tree health.
Once the assessment is finished, the arborist shares their conclusions with the property owner, outlining any concerns found and their consequences. They offer customized guidance on tree care, which may include shaping, feeding, or pest mitigation approaches. The arborist may also advise planting additional trees or upgrading the grounds to promote overall ecosystem health. This discussion not only tackles current problems but also lays the groundwork for a comprehensive tree maintenance strategy, ensuring the vitality and longevity of the landscape.

What Certifications Should I Seek in an Arborist?
When seeking an arborist, verify certifications such as ISA (International Society of Arboriculture) certification, accreditation from the TCIA (Tree Care Industry Association), and local licenses. These qualifications reflect knowledge of tree care practices and professional industry standards.
